Southampton Early Years Development & Childcare Partnership
The Partnership is made up of members from the voluntary, private, statutory and independent sectors. Its aim is to help develop early years and childcare provision throughout the city for children aged 0-14, and up to age 16 for children with disabilities. The Partnership provides support for early years and childcare providers to meet the Care Standards and registration requirements. It also helps providers to raise quality by offering training, business and marketing support.
There is a range of early years and childcare settings throughout the city, including pre-schools, playgroups and day nurseries. Some young children may be offered a place at an Early Years Inclusive Centre or nursery attached to a special school, where their specific needs will be met. Once your child is at school you may wish them to attend an out of school club.
All early years and childcare settings offer inclusive provision and have policies to make sure they offer equal opportunities for all children, including those with special needs. To make sure your child gets the right support, please discuss their needs with the childcare provider as soon as possible. Additional funding and support is available to providers to help them meet any extra requirements. You will need to pay for child care, but if you are working you can use Working Tax Credit and other benefits you receive to help with this cost. Part time funded early education is also available to all children from the term after their third birthday.
